Presenting the interim and final Rail Budget of UPA-II on Feb 12, 2014, Railway Minister Mallikarjun Kharge announced 73 new long-distance trains and 19 new lines and no fare hike.

BSE Sensex Intraday Movement: BSE Sensex on Feb 12, 2014 rose 85.12 points, logging its best gain in three weeks, to end at 20,448.49 buoyed by jump in bluechips like ICICI Bank, Reliance Industries and L&T ahead of industrial output and retail inflation data.

Gold and silver prices: After two days of gains, gold prices dropped by Rs 50 to Rs 30,750 per ten gram in the national capital on Feb 12, 2014 on emergence of profit-selling by stockists at existing higher levels amid weak global trend.

Indian rupee through the day against US dollar: Rising for the second day, the Indian rupee strenghtened by 12 paise to end at a three-week high of 62.1 against the US dollar on Feb 12, 2014.

BSE Sensex and NSE Nifty throughout the day: ICICI Bank (3.11 per cent), GAIL (2.57 per cent) and ONGC (2.50 per cent) led the 17 gainers in 30-share BSE index on Feb 12, 2014.

Indian rupee vs US dollar: The Indian rupee traded in a tight range in otherwise listless trade as participants eyed domestic industrial production data and retail inflation figure on Feb 12, 2014.
